> I've made the following changes:
> 1) State borders are thicker
> 2) Secondary roads are narrower and the colour saturation has been reduced
> 3) Railway lines are a little blacker.
>

State borders are definitely an improvement.

I'm not sure about the secondary roads.  At zoom 8, the previous render 
looks good, but it gets overwhelming once zoomed out a bit. (starting 
around zoom 6 I guess?)  Maybe just the narrowing, without touching the 
color would be better?  Or maybe less reduction of the saturation.

Railway lines are a big improvement, but should probably be a touch 
darker yet..  (IMO their visibility should be just below that of primary 
roads; they're currently just below secondary in visibility.)
